Guariba Preta vs plicate door snail
Alouatta nigerrima compared with Macrogastra plicatula
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Guariba Preta | plicate door snail |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(cordados) | Mollusca (Moluscos) |
| Class | Mammalia (mamíferos) | Gastropoda (Gastrópodes) |
| Order | Primates (primatas) | Stylommatophora (Stylommatophora) |
| Family | Atelidae | Clausiliidae |
| Genus | Alouatta | Macrogastra |
| Species | Alouatta nigerrima | Macrogastra plicatula |
Evolutionary Relationship
Guariba Preta and plicate door snail share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
